Output 130761eaf6dace03e7e652c8477a248058e81261daf6feb0b2ba9132aae9e14a:3

value
31240287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a77c3b6671bbddc5e2a6c7a85a02850f465503 OP_EQUAL
address
MDybUAx4eWt461UsieWFGx5rQ6QUt3PvK8
transaction
130761eaf6dace03e7e652c8477a248058e81261daf6feb0b2ba9132aae9e14a
spent
true